In December, the IRS launched a delay in reporting thresholds for third-party settlement organizations set to take influence for the 2022 tax submitting season.
Effectively-known third-party settlement organizations (TPSOs) embody Venmo, PayPal, and Money App.
That suggests that for the tax 12 months 2022, the prevailing 1099-Okay reporting threshold of $20,000 in funds from over 200 transactions will keep in influence.

Lisa Greene-Lewis: Sure, numerous individuals have been frightened about this, like hundreds and hundreds further tax filers may have acquired this fashion. However on December 23, the IRS dominated to delay the reporting requirement. So the reporting requirement was going to go, do you have to had over $600 in third-party provider transactions, you’d get a sort 1099-Okay. However that delay made it so that you’ll not get one besides you’ve over 200 transactions and $20,000. A lot extra transactions and money sooner than you’d see this fashion.

Tracy Byrnes: I get that. OK, so if I definitely do get a 1099-Okay, what do I do with it? I’ve to report it I’m guessing someplace.
Lisa Greene-Lewis: Sure, you do must report it, notably do you have to’re self-employed. And one issue to degree out, this isn’t a model new tax laws. Self-employed have been on a regular basis alleged to report their net earnings whether it is $400 or further. And irrespective of any earnings, you’re alleged to report it. So it is just a reporting requirement for the third-party suppliers. They are often those who may be sending you these varieties. You’ll report irrespective of’s on that sort. Keep in mind, do you have to’re self-employed, though, there are tons of deductions which will lower your whole earnings and reduce the taxes you pay.
Tracy Byrnes: And the alternative issue you recognized, though, was that some states actually nonetheless have been giving these 1099-Ks out. How come?
Lisa Greene-Lewis: Yeah, it’s dependent upon the state. If that they’d conformity with the delay that the IRS issued. So it merely depends upon the particular person states.
